MANILA, Philippines — The Manila city government’s Department of Public Services (DPS) cleaned up the debris left by Severe Tropical Storm Florita on Tuesday.

Personnel of the DPS collected garbage scattered along Quirino Avenue in Barangay 853, Dagupan street in Barangay 156 and Barangay 902.

DPS workers also cleared fallen trees along Jose Abad Santos Avenue near Mayhaligue street.

Sacks of trash were seen washed ashore by the storm at the Manila Bay dolomite beach.

Workers from the Metropolitan Manila Development Authority and DPS personnel used rakes in collecting the garbage.
